The City of Geneva is working on a water main infrastructure project along the Route 25 corridor (North Bennett Street). The primary project involves installing a new water main on the state highway from State (Route 38) to Jefferson streets. Construction began in October.
Dec. 12 Update
The City is anticipating construction will last about three more weeks, weather permitting.
While Route 25 continues to be closed at State Street (Route 38), the Wall Street intersection has been reopened to local traffic. Jefferson Street is currently closed as crews work on making the water main connection followed by concrete work.
As a reminder, businesses along State Street and Route 25 remain open to local traffic. See the City's local business access map.
